Caldera $ERA: Understanding the Project Behind the Hype of Its Coinbase Listing
As the cryptocurrency landscape continues to evolve, projects that prioritize scalability and performance are gaining significant traction. One such project is Caldera (ERA), which recently caught the attention of the market following its listing on Coinbase, a leading global crypto exchange. But before assessing the implications of this listing, it's vital to understand what Caldera represents and why it matters in the broader blockchain ecosystem.
What Is Caldera?
Caldera is a blockchain infrastructure platform designed to empower developers by simplifying the process of launching and managing custom blockchains. These tailor-made chains are often referred to as rollups or appchains—specialized chains built to handle specific decentralized applications (dApps) or use cases.
By enabling developers to spin up application-specific blockchains, Caldera aims to enhance scalability, reduce transaction costs, and offload congestion from major Layer 1 blockchains like Ethereum. In a time where gas fees and network delays can hinder user experience, Caldera’s infrastructure offers a compelling solution.
What Role Does the ERA Token Play?
The ERA token is the native utility token of the Caldera ecosystem. It underpins various aspects of network activity and user interaction. The primary functions of the ERA token include:
Governance: ERA token holders have the power to participate in key decisions regarding protocol upgrades, ecosystem funding, and development priorities.
Staking: Depending on future network mechanisms, users may stake ERA tokens to help secure the ecosystem and potentially earn rewards in return.
Fee Payments: ERA may also be used to pay for transaction fees, services, or infrastructure usage within the Caldera network.
This multi-utility approach ensures that ERA plays a central role in sustaining and growing the Caldera environment.
